Rogue Community Health is looking for a referral coordinator to join our team. Our referral coordinators are committed to excellent patient care, go the extra mile, will look under every rock until a solution can be found, and know at the end of the day that they made a difference in someone else’s life. On the outside, processing a patient’s medical referral might sound easy, but it takes the right amount of passion to ensure that the services a patient receives are accurate, and timely, communications are clear, all research has been done appropriately, and most importantly, and the patient experience is seamless and has a positive outcome. Expectations are compliance with organizational policies, procedures, standards of care, and related laws and regulations including HIPAA, and OSHA, regulations.
Enjoy stable hours, competitive pay, and benefits.
Required to complete a criminal background check, and pre-employment drug screen once a conditional offer is accepted.
Oregon is an employment-at-will state and Rogue Community Health (RCH) has a 90-day probationary period for all newly hired team members.
